The white wine Sauvignon Blanc, vintage 2020 from the winery Klosterkeller der Barmherzigen Brüder has been rated in 2021 by Peter Moser with 90 Falstaff points. It is a wine made from the grape variety Sauvignon Blanc from the region Leithaberg in Austria.
Tasting Notes
Light yellow-green with silver reflections. Delicate notes of gooseberries, white peach and grapefruit on the nose, with a floral touch. The palate is taut, with a core of white pome fruit and a fresh structure leading to a mineral-lemon finish. A crisp summer wine with a delicately leafy finish.
